Добавлен: 28.06.2023
Просмотров: 75
Скачиваний: 2
<?php include("includes/header.php"); ?>
<title>Главная</title>
</head>
<body>
<?php include("includes/Home.php"); ?>
<?php include("includes/footer.php"); ?>
</body>
</html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<link rel="shortcut icon" href="images/icons/logo.png" type="ico/png"/>
<link rel="stylesheet" href="add/Style.css">
<div id='header'>
<img src="images/icons/logo.png" width="80" height="80" alt="header"/>parate Entertainment</a>
</div>
<div class="blok-menu">
<ul class="menu">
<li><a href="index.php">Главная</a></li>
<li><a href="news.php">Новости</a></li>
<li><a href="protech.php">Таблица продуктов</a></li>
<li><a href="galery.php">Галерея проектов</a></li>
<li><a href="company.php">Команда</a></li>
<li><a href="contacts.php">Контакты</a></li>
<li><div class="circle"><a href="login.php"><img src="images/icons/login.png" width="10" height="10" alt="login"/></a></li></div>
</ul>
</div>
</head>
<link rel="stylesheet" href="add/tech.css">
<div id='footer'>
© Separate Entertainment 2020
</div>
Подключаемая страница «Главная»
<div id='content'>
<p><br>Добро пожаловать на сайт команды разработчиков Separate entertainment</br></br></br></br></br></br></br></br></p>
<style>
body
{
background-image: url('images/general.jpg');
background-repeat: no-repeat;
background-size: cover;
background-size: auto 700px;
background-position: 50% 70%;
}
</style>
<link rel="stylesheet" href="add/tech.css">
<center><table>
<col style="width: 200px;">
<col style="width: 500px;">
<col style="width: 100px;">
<thead>
<tr>
<th colspan="3"><center>Планы разработок</th>
</tr>
</thead>
<tbody>
<tr>
<th><center>Дата релиза</th>
<td><center>Описание</td>
<td><center>Готовность</td>
</tr>
<tr>
<td><center><font color="grey">Июль 2020</font></td>
<td>Выпуск GGO Technology 1.2</td>
<td><center><font color="Red">25%</font></td>
</tr>
<tr>
<td><center><font color="grey">Октябрь 2020</font></td>
<td>Выпуск Heritage - The Fall of the King v0.1.0a</td>
<td><center><font color="Red">30%</font></td>
</tr>
<tr>
<td><center><font color="grey">2020 год</font></td>
<td>Выпуск My Home Environment v0.2</td>
<td><center><font color="red">0%</font></td>
</tr>
<tr>
<td><center><font color="grey">2021 год</font></td>
<td>Выпуск Burning Out Tires</td>
<td><center><font color="Red">0%</font></td>
</tr>
</tbody>
<tfoot>
<td><center><font color="grey">2021 год</font></td>
<td>Выпуск The Sudden Fire</td>
<td><center><font color="Red">0%</font></td>
</tfoot>
</table>
</div>
<?php require_once("includes/connection.php"); ?>
<?php
$query = "SELECT * FROM news";
$req = mysqli_query($connection, $query);
$data_from_db = [];
while ($result = mysqli_fetch_assoc($req))
{
$data_from_db[] = $result;
}
//var_dump($data_from_db);
?>
<html>
<head>
<?php include("includes/header.php"); ?>
<title>Новости компании</title>
</head>
<body>
<div id ='content'>
<?php foreach($data_from_db as $news): ?>
<div class = "content1">
<h2>
<?php echo $news['title']?>
</h2>
<p>
<br>
<img src="<?php echo $news['img']?>" widht="150" height = "150" alt = "">
</p>
<p>
<br>
<?php echo $news['mini_decs']?>
</p>
<p align="right">
<br>
<?php echo $news['about']?>
</p>
<a href="about.php?id=<?php echo $news['id']?>">
Подробнее
</a>
</div>
<?php endforeach; ?>
</div>
<footer>
<?php include("includes/footer.php"); ?>
</footer>
</body>
</html>
<div id='content'>
</br><p>Галерея разработчиков Separate entertainment</p></br>
<link rel="stylesheet" href="add/general.css">
<div class="slider">
<div class="item">
<img src="images/screenshots/1.png" alt="Первый слайд">
<div class="slideText"></div>
</div>
<div class="item">
<img src="images/screenshots/2.png" alt="Второй слайд">
<div class="slideText"></div>
</div>
<div class="item">
<img src="images/screenshots/3.png" alt="Третий слайд">
<div class="slideText"></div>
</div>
<div class="item">
<img src="images/screenshots/4.png" alt="Третий слайд">
<div class="slideText"></div>
</div>
<a class="prev" onclick="minusSlide()">❮</a>
<a class="next" onclick="plusSlide()">❯</a>
</div>
<br>
<div class="slider-dots">
<span class="slider-dots_item" onclick="currentSlide(1)"></span>
<span class="slider-dots_item" onclick="currentSlide(2)"></span>
<span class="slider-dots_item" onclick="currentSlide(3)"></span>
<span class="slider-dots_item" onclick="currentSlide(4)"></span>
</div>
</br>Разрабатываемый проект Heritage - The Fall of the King
<script src="add/script.js"></script>
</div>
JS переключение картинок
var slideIndex = 1;
showSlides(slideIndex);
function plusSlide() {
showSlides(slideIndex += 1);
}
function minusSlide() {
showSlides(slideIndex -= 1);
}
function currentSlide(n) {
showSlides(slideIndex = n);
}
function showSlides(n) {
var i;
var slides = document.getElementsByClassName("item");
var dots = document.getElementsByClassName("slider-dots_item");
if (n > slides.length) {
slideIndex = 1
}
if (n < 1) {
slideIndex = slides.length
}
for (i = 0; i < slides.length; i++) {
slides[i].style.display = "none";
}
for (i = 0; i < dots.length; i++) {
dots[i].className = dots[i].className.replace(" active", "");
}
slides[slideIndex - 1].style.display = "block";
dots[slideIndex - 1].className += " active";
}
Раздел Контакты
<div id='content'>
<div class="content">
<h2>Контакты Separate Entertainment</h2>
</br>
<p>Наш офис находится по адресу: МО, г.Балашиха мкр. Дзержинского д.51</p></br>
<center><script type="text/javascript" charset="utf-8" async src="https://api-maps.yandex.ru/services/constructor/1.0/js/?um=constructor%3Adb95c57631035f6fc597caf65ab8ebcce40d619b2383a5bb8e119f91e98ca26c&width=702&height=565&lang=ru_RU&scroll=true"></script>
</br>
<p>Наш офис распологается в панельном жилом доме в 8 км от МКАД по Шоссе Энтузиастов</p>
</br>
<p>Контактный номер: 8-(925)-644-12-10</p>
</div>
</div>
Форма Аторизации и Регистрации
Авторизация
<!DOCTYPE html>
<html lang="ru">
<?php
session_start();
?>
<?php require_once("includes/connection.php"); ?>
<?php
if(isset($_SESSION["session_username"])){
header("Location: /intropage.php");
} else {}
if(isset($_POST["login"])){
$username=htmlspecialchars($_POST['username']);
$password=htmlspecialchars($_POST['password']);
if(!empty($username) && !empty($password)) {
$query =mysqli_query($connection, "SELECT * FROM userlistdb WHERE username = '".$username."' AND password='".$password."'");
$numrows=mysqli_num_rows($query);
if($numrows!=0){
while($row=mysqli_fetch_assoc($query)){
$dbusername=$row['username'];
$dbpassword=$row['password'];
}
if($username == $dbusername && $password == $dbpassword) {
$_SESSION['session_username']=$username;
require('includes/redirect.php');
exit();
}
} else {
echo "Неверное имя пользователя или пароль!";
}
} else {
$message = "Все поля обязательны для заполнения!";
}
}
?>
<head>
<?php include("includes/header.php"); ?>
<title>Авторизация пользователя</title>
</head>
<body>
<div id="content">
<div class="container">
<h1>Вход</h1>
<form action="login.php" id="loginform" method="post"name="loginform">
<p><label for="user_login">Имя пользователя<br>
<input class="input" id="username" name="username"size="20"
type="text" value=""></label></p>
<p><label for="user_pass">Пароль<br>
<input class="input" id="password" name="password"size="20"
type="password" value=""></label></p>
<p class="submit"><input class="button" name="login"type= "submit" value="Войти"></p>
<p class="regtext">Еще не зарегистрированы?
<a href="register.php">Регистрация</a>!</p>
</form>
</div>
</div>
</body>
<?php include("includes/footer.php"); ?>
</html>
Регистрация
<!DOCTYPE html>
<html lang="ru">
<?php require_once("includes/connection.php"); ?>
<?php
if(isset($_POST["register"])){
$full_name= htmlspecialchars($_POST['full_name']);
$email=htmlspecialchars($_POST['email']);
$username=htmlspecialchars($_POST['username']);
$password=htmlspecialchars($_POST['password']);
if(!empty($full_name) && !empty($email) && !empty($username) && !empty($password)) {
$query=mysqli_query($connection, "SELECT * FROM userlistdb WHERE username = '".$username."'");
$numrows=mysqli_num_rows($query);
if($numrows==0) {
$sql="INSERT INTO userlistdb (full_name, email, username, password) VALUES ('$full_name', '$email', '$username', '$password')";
$result=mysqli_query($connection, $sql);
if($result){
$message = "Аккаунт успешно создан!";